The Importance of a Reliable Locksmith

Losing or damaging your car key can be more than just a trouble; it can be a significant security problem. Modern car keys are equipped with advanced security features like transponders, chips, and fobs, making it hard to replicate or replace them without specialized understanding and equipment. A reliable locksmith can use a series of services, including key duplication, lock rekeying, and even programming new keyless entry systems. They can likewise help you regain access to your vehicle quickly and safely.

What Services Does a Locksmith Offer?

When you look for a "locksmith near me" for car key services, you can anticipate a variety of professional services:

  1. Key Duplication

    • Requirement Keys: Creating a specific copy of your existing car key.
    • Transponder Keys: Duplicating keys which contain a microchip to prevent unapproved gain access to.
    • Laser-Cut Keys: Replicating keys with detailed cuts that fit modern, high-security locks.
  2. Key Extraction and Replacement

    • Broken Keys: Removing a broken key from the lock and changing it with a new one.
    • Stuck Keys: If your key is stuck in the ignition or door lock, a locksmith can safely eliminate it without harming the lock.
  3. Key Programming

    • Remote Fobs: Programming new or replacement remote fobs for keyless entry systems.
    • Smart Keys: Configuring wise keys that can begin the car without physical insertion.
  4. Lock Rekeying

    • Changing Locks: Rekeying your car's locks to use a new key, improving security.
    • Master Key Systems: Setting up a master key system for fleet lorries or businesses.
  5. Emergency Situation Lockout Assistance

    • 24/7 Availability: Most dependable locksmith professionals offer 24/7 emergency situation services to help you regain access to your vehicle at any time.
  6. High-Security Lock Installation

    • Updating Locks: Installing high-security locks to improve the general security of your vehicle.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: Can a locksmith make a copy of my car key without the initial?

  • A: In lots of cases, a locksmith can create a new key if you have the vehicle's VIN number and evidence of ownership. Nevertheless, this process might vary depending on the make and model of your car and the security functions of your key. For high-security keys, the original key is typically needed for duplication.

Q: How long does it take to get a replicate car key?

  • A: The time it takes to duplicate a car key can vary depending upon the kind of key and the locksmith's work. Requirement keys can frequently be duplicated within minutes, while more intricate keys like transponder or laser-cut keys might take 30 minutes to an hour.

Q: What should I do if my car key is broken inside the lock?

  • A: Do not try to force the key out, as this can damage the lock even more. Rather, call a professional locksmith who has the tools and knowledge to securely extract the broken key without triggering extra damage.

Q: Can a locksmith program my car's remote fob?

  • A: Yes, a professional locksmith can program a brand-new or replacement remote fob for your car. This process includes synchronizing the fob with your car's computer system, which may need particular diagnostic tools.

Q: Are mobile locksmith services as reliable as those with a physical shop?

  • A: Mobile locksmiths can be simply as reputable and often easier. Look for mobile locksmiths who are licensed, guaranteed, and have favorable evaluations. They need to have the ability to provide the exact same quality services as a shop-based locksmith.
